从零到VPS,个人网站搭建指南
卡尔云官网
www.kaeryun.com
在当今互联网时代,个人网站已经成为展示个人品牌、分享内容和赚取收入的重要平台,而搭建一个稳定、安全的个人网站,VPS(虚拟专用服务器)是一个非常高效的选择,如何从零开始搭建VPS呢?别担心,我将带你一步步走过这个过程。
什么是VPS?
VPS,全称是Virtual Private Server,中文叫虚拟专用服务器,VPS就像是一台虚拟的计算机,你只需要支付比普通个人电脑便宜得多的钱,就可以在上面运行你的网站,与共享主机不同,VPS资源有限,但又不像独立服务器那样昂贵,适合个人或小型网站的需求。
选择合适的云服务提供商
搭建VPS的第一步是选择一家可靠的云服务提供商,目前市场上的云服务提供商有很多,比如阿里云、AWS(亚马逊云服务)、Google Cloud、DigitalOcean、HostGator等,每家提供商都有其特点,比如价格、技术支持、服务器配置等,建议你根据自己的预算和需求来选择。
注册账户并购买虚拟机
注册云服务提供商的账户后,就需要购买虚拟机了,购买虚拟机的步骤通常是这样的:
- 注册账户:访问云服务提供商的官网,注册一个账户。
- 选择虚拟机:进入虚拟机页面,选择适合你需求的虚拟机类型,如果你只需要运行一个网站,可以选择一个最小的虚拟机,比如2GB内存、20GB存储空间的配置。
- 购买虚拟机:根据提供的价格表,选择一个合适的虚拟机,然后进行购买,购买后,系统会自动创建一个虚拟机实例。
登录虚拟机
购买虚拟机后,你需要登录进去,登录方式通常是通过虚拟机的控制台,登录后,你会看到一个类似Windows系统的界面,你可以在这里管理你的虚拟机,比如重启、升级系统等。
安装操作系统
大多数云服务提供商都支持多种操作系统,比如Linux、Windows等,如果你选择的是Linux,那么安装步骤会比较简单,如果是Windows,可能需要一些额外的步骤。
安装操作系统时,记得选择一个稳定的版本,并按照指引一步步完成安装,安装完成后,你可以进入虚拟机的主界面,开始配置你的网站。
配置VPS
配置VPS主要是指为你的网站分配资源,比如内存、存储空间、带宽等,这一步非常重要,因为配置不当,可能会导致网站运行不稳定或无法访问。
配置资源时,你可以根据你的需求来选择,如果你的网站很小,可以选择较小的内存和存储空间,如果你的网站有较多的内容或用户,可能需要选择更大的配置。
安装PHP框架
大多数个人网站都是使用PHP开发的,所以安装PHP框架是必要的,PHP框架可以帮助你快速开发出功能完善的网站,安装PHP框架的步骤通常是通过控制台来完成的。
安装完成后,你可以进入网站管理界面,开始搭建你的网站。
配置域名
域名是你的网站名字,比如你的名字加上.com,比如www.你的名字.com,配置域名需要通过控制台来完成,你需要注册一个域名,然后将域名指向你的VPS。
配置SSL证书
为了提高网站的安全性,建议你为你的网站配置一个SSL证书,SSL证书可以有效提升网站的信任度,同时也能提高网站的加载速度。
配置SSL证书的步骤通常是通过控制台来完成的,你需要选择一个 trusted CA сертификат (可信CA证书),然后按照指引完成证书的配置。
设置安全措施
为了确保你的网站安全,你需要设置一些基本的安全措施,限制访问权限、启用防火墙、定期备份数据等,这些措施可以帮助你避免网站被攻击或数据被泄露。
十一、测试和部署
在完成所有配置后,你需要对网站进行测试,确保一切正常,测试完成后,就可以将网站部署到你的VPS上了。
十二、监控和维护
部署完成后,你需要开始监控你的网站,确保它一直正常运行,还需要定期维护网站,比如更新软件、升级系统等。
搭建一个VPS并不是一件难事,只要按照上述步骤一步步来,你就可以轻松地搭建出一个稳定、安全的个人网站,这只是整个过程的概述,每个步骤都需要仔细操作,确保每一步都正确无误,希望这篇文章能帮助你顺利搭建自己的VPS,拥有属于自己的网站!
卡尔云官网
www.kaeryun.com